Establish the importance of financial records in HUF audits

Introduction

Financial records form the foundation of accountability, transparency, and compliance in the functioning of a Hindu Undivided Family (HUF). As HUFs are separate taxable entities under the Income Tax Act, they are required to maintain books of account when engaged in business or professional activities. During a tax audit or statutory audit, these records are essential for substantiating income, verifying expenses, and supporting claims for deductions. Proper maintenance of financial records ensures legal compliance, reduces the risk of penalties, and enhances financial discipline within the family.

Requirement under the Income Tax Act

Section 44AA of the Income Tax Act mandates the maintenance of books of accounts for HUFs involved in business or professional activities that exceed specific income or turnover thresholds. These records help demonstrate the true and correct income of the HUF and serve as the primary documentation in case of scrutiny by the Assessing Officer. Without these records, the HUF may face disallowance of expenses and increased tax liability.

Preparation for Tax Audit under Section 44AB

If the turnover of an HUF engaged in business exceeds ₹1 crore or professional receipts exceed ₹50 lakhs, a tax audit becomes mandatory. In such cases, maintaining accurate books, including ledgers, cash books, inventory registers, and bank statements, is critical. The auditor relies on these documents to prepare Form 3CA/3CB and Form 3CD. In the absence of proper records, auditors may issue a qualified opinion, leading to potential legal consequences.

Verification of Incomes and Expenses

Financial records validate the source of incom,e such as business profits, rent, dividends, and capital gains. They also support the genuineness of expenses claimed under various sections of the Act. These include salaries to members, interest on loans, depreciation on assets, and administrative costs. During an audit, only documented expenses are allowed as deductions. Hence, incomplete or unrecorded transactions may lead to additions to income.

Capital Account and Asset Tracking

The capital account of the HUF reflects contributions, gifts received, profits retained, and withdrawals made over the years. This account must reconcile with the overall financial position of the HUF. Accurate records also help in tracking assets like land, buildings, vehicles, and investments. These are essential not only for audit but also for property distribution in case of partition.

GST and Other Statutory Compliances

If the HUF is registered under GST or other regulatory frameworks, financial records must align with returns filed under those laws. Mismatches in turnover, tax payments, or reconciliation can trigger cross-verification by authorities. Financial records ensure that the HUF is compliant across multiple regulatory platforms.

Audit Trail and Legal Safeguard

Financial records provide an audit trail that protects the HUF in case of disputes with tax authorities or family members. In cases of litigation, partition, or succession, these records serve as legal evidence of ownership, income, and distribution of assets. Proper documentation also helps defend against allegations of concealment, mismanagement, or fraud.
